The song features Tony Moran, Jon Secada, and Tony Coluccio. Tony Moran is a producer/remixer, Jon Secada is a Latin pop singer, and Tony Coluccio contributes vocals, all collaborating on the 2000 album 'Better Part Of Me'.
'Better Part Of Me' was released in the year 2000, and 'Speak To The Wind' is one of its tracks. It marked a collaborative effort between the artists during that period.
The song blends dance-pop and Latin-influenced elements, typical of Tony Moran’s production style and Jon Secada’s vocal range. It falls under genres like dance, pop, or Latin pop, with a rhythmic structure suitable for clubs and radio.
